Signs of Dental Emergency Situations



Identifying the signs of oral emergency situations is critical for prompt action and proper treatment. If you can try these out experience serious tooth discomfort that's constant and throbbing, it might suggest a hidden concern that calls for instant interest.

Swelling in the gum tissues, face, or jaw can likewise be a sign of a dental emergency situation, particularly if it's accompanied by discomfort or fever. Any kind of type of trauma to the mouth causing a split, broken, or knocked-out tooth must be dealt with as an emergency to stop further damages and potential infection.

Hemorrhaging from the mouth that does not quit after applying pressure for a couple of mins is another warning that you should look for emergency dental treatment. Furthermore, if you discover any type of indicators of infection such as pus, a nasty taste in your mouth, or a high temperature, it's vital to see a dental practitioner as soon as possible.

Neglecting these indications can cause much more severe issues, so it's vital to act promptly when confronted with a prospective dental emergency situation.
